Rashmika Mandanna, widely adored as the National Crush, is set to charm audiences with her new romantic drama The Girlfriend, co-starring Dheekshith Shetty. Helmed by director Rahul Ravindran and produced by Dheeraj Mogilineni and Vidya Koppineedi under Geetha Arts and Dheeraj Mogilineni Entertainment, the film is presented by industry stalwart Allu Aravind.
To build excitement, the makers released a compelling announcement video on Dussehra, confirming a Pan-India release in five languages—Hindi, Telugu, Tamil, Malayalam, and Kannada—on November 7, 2025. The Girlfriend promises an emotionally rich narrative that explores modern relationships, compatibility, and love’s complexities. The film features vibrant cinematography from Krishnan Vasant, a soulful score by Hesham Abdul Wahab, and editing by Chota K Prasad.
